To write 0.00375 as a percent have to remember that 1 equal 100% and that what you need to do is just to multiply the number by 100 and add at the end symbol % . 0.00375 * 100 = 0.375%. And finally we have: 0.00375 as a percent equals 0.375%.

Príklady použitia. 40 % alkohol – V každom litri tejto tekutiny je 0,4 litra alkoholu (a zvyšok, čiže 60 %, tvoria iné látky – tzv. objemové percento); 15 % zvýšenie ceny – Po tomto zvýšení stojí daná vec 1,15-násobok pôvodnej ceny; ak bola predtým cena 100 €, po zvýšení bude stáť 115 €.
